Pros
Great company with lots of opportunity for advancement and career changes with god benefits, and good pay. I worked at the company for over 10 years and learned a lot about retail and B2B investments. Have a few FINRA licenses (24,65, 63, 7, 31, and Insurance) and was working towards my CFP that was supported and sponsored. There are also lots of internal and OTJ trainings. Plenty of great people and some pretty awesome financial industry leaders. It's a privately owned company so if they want to pursue something they don't have to get the stock holder's buy in and they allow the employees to provide input on a lot of the process and employee engagement improvements that are currently in place. Overall it's a very dynamic culture constantly changing.
Cons
Super lager company so you could feel like just another worker and that your voice doesn't count. At times the hiring process when moving between roles can be a bit monotonous (in that it's a hurry up to wait months situation). Overall it's a very dynamic culture and constantly changing so if change is not what you like this probably isn't for you.
